Sound and Story – The Ritz, Newburgh

This is the second piece I produced for Eileen McAdam’s Newburgh Beacon Audio Adventure Tour, part of the Sound and Story Project of the Hudson Valley. In this segment, long-time Newburgh resident Kathleen Gill talks about how Newburgh used to be a vibrant arts center, and all the stars who performed at the Ritz in its heyday. Sound and Story – Dia:Beacon

I had the privilege of producing a couple stories for Eileen McAdam’s Newburgh Beacon Audio Adventure Tour, part of the Sound and Story Project of the Hudson Valley. The first is about the building that now houses Dia:Beacon. It was built in 1929 to produce millions of cookie and cracker boxes for the Nabisco company. Long-time Beacon resident and former Nabisco employee John Ballo talks about how the building’s natural light created the perfect setting for cookie box color correction as well as modern art viewing.
